Understand How Popup Ads Is Delivered
Popup Ads use a new browser window or tab that is presented in front of the active page after an eligible user interaction. Delivery depends on browser popup controls, device behavior, publisher implementation, user permission, platform policy and supply-partner rules. Delivery can differ across operating systems, browsers, devices and supply partners, so preview the actual unit rather than assuming every impression looks identical. The campaign path normally includes an eligible impression, a platform decision, creative rendering, a click, a destination request and an attributed outcome. For high quality popup ad network, record where each identifier is created and where it can be lost. This map makes it easier to separate a creative problem from a landing-page problem, a tracking gap or a weak source.

Create a Reliable Click-to-Outcome Chain
Append a unique click ID and campaign, creative, source and placement parameters where the platform supports them. Return validated events through a server-to-server postback or another reliable integration, and align time zones, attribution windows and duplicate rules across platform, tracker, analytics and backend systems. Before meaningful spend on high quality popup ad network, complete a live test click and confirm the exact value stored in every system. Decide which backend is authoritative when totals disagree. Review the first data in fixed windows so isolated clicks do not control the campaign. The goal is not perfect agreement between tools. It is enough evidence to make the same source decision twice.
Normalize Price Into Acquisition Economics
Popup Ads may be bought through CPC, CPM, SmartCPC or another auction model depending on inventory and platform. Normalize the media cost into effective CPC, accepted CPA, revenue per click and contribution after variable costs. For high quality popup ad network, a low CPM can be expensive when engagement and accepted conversion rates are weak, while a higher bid can be efficient when the source produces valuable outcomes. Start with a conservative conversion assumption and calculate the maximum bid from the value of an accepted result. Do not publish or rely on one universal market rate. GEO, competition, device mix, seasonality and source quality can change the clearing price quickly.
Protect the First Test With Explicit Limits
Set a daily cap, campaign cap, bid ceiling and maximum acceptable test loss. The budget should be large enough to observe several sources and time periods, but small enough that a failed hypothesis does not damage the account. For high quality popup ad network, separate exploration from scaling. Exploration collects evidence across inventory. Scaling concentrates spend on combinations that remain inside the accepted acquisition range. Use frequency limits when available, especially when the message has a short useful life. Pause automatically or manually when tracking breaks, the destination fails, policy status changes or rejection rates exceed the planned tolerance.

Check Traffic Quality Without Relying on Labels
A valid click is not automatically a valuable customer, so reconcile platform events with the advertiser backend. For high quality popup ad network, investigate unusually fast clicks, repeated identifiers, concentrated conversion timing, large tracker gaps, invalid backend records and sources that generate engagement without accepted value. Use fraud and quality controls as filters and diagnostic tools, not as a substitute for commercial validation. Review changes after enough volume has accumulated and keep an export before major exclusions. The advertiser should also inspect its own form validation, payment failures, call-center handling and fulfillment because operational rejection can be mistaken for traffic fraud.
Optimize Sources, Bids and Creative Separately
Begin with source-level decisions because blended campaign averages hide strong and weak placements. Next, compare destination and offer angles under similar inventory. Then evaluate device, operating system, browser, carrier, GEO and time-of-day segments when enough accepted outcomes exist. For high quality popup ad network, avoid simultaneous bid, creative and landing-page changes because the resulting data cannot explain which decision helped. Increase bids or caps in measured steps, often around 15 to 25 percent, and wait for a new stable sample. Use whitelists when evidence supports concentration, but keep a controlled exploration campaign so the account can discover new supply.
Scale Marginal Performance, Not the Blended Average
Scaling changes auction position, frequency, source mix and user quality, so the original acquisition cost may not survive a large increase. Track the marginal accepted CPA or contribution from each expansion step. High Quality Popup Ad Network can be expanded through higher caps, higher bids, more creative, new GEOs, additional devices or broader source access. Test one route at a time and preserve a holdout or baseline where practical. Stop expanding when accepted cost leaves the planned range, backend quality deteriorates, the destination slows or the operation cannot serve new customers correctly. A scalable campaign is one that remains measurable and supportable, not merely one that spends more.
Protect User Trust and Brand Safety
Use truthful advertiser identity, accurate claims, appropriate age and GEO restrictions, functioning privacy disclosures and a destination that matches the creative. Do not imitate browser, operating-system, antivirus, banking or account-security alerts. For high quality popup ad network, avoid false urgency, fabricated endorsements, misleading close buttons and any message that makes users believe the destination was opened by their device, browser or a trusted service when it was not. Review the platform policy, offer policy and local advertising rules before launch. Approval is not a permanent legal or brand-safety determination, so recheck the campaign when creative, destination or targeting changes.

High Quality Popup Ad Network FAQ
What makes a high-quality popup ad network manageable?
Manageable popup inventory gives the buyer enough context and control to act. Source visibility, practical exclusions, browser-aware delivery, and outcome reporting provide that foundation. Large reach is less useful when weak placements cannot be isolated.
How much publisher transparency should a popup network provide?
The network should provide enough source or placement detail to compare quality and act on the result. When publisher names are restricted, stable identifiers and category controls still need to support decisions.
Which browser checks belong before a popup campaign goes live?
Browser checks should prove that the full popup route remains usable. The window needs to open correctly, preserve tracking, show the right destination, and remain easy to close. Testing common browsers and devices prevents a route defect from being mistaken for bad traffic.
Can frequency controls improve popup traffic quality?
Frequency controls can protect visitors from repeated interruptions and help the buyer reach a broader audience. Their effect should be read beside source-level response rather than treated as a universal fix.
Where can popup brand-safety problems originate?
Popup brand-safety problems can begin at more than one point in the route. Publisher context, opening behavior, destination, claims, and repetition each deserve inspection. A useful investigation keeps those causes separate before removing an entire channel.
What billing detail clarifies the real cost of a popup network?
Real acquisition cost depends on more than the auction price. Platform fees, deposits, rejected outcomes, and source mix all contribute. Media price should be compared with accepted customer value under the same attribution rules.
How is popup routing validated from source to outcome?
A live route test follows the source identifier through redirects, the landing page, and the advertiser's accepted event. Matching time zones and duplicate rules makes the resulting record easier to reconcile.
When does unusual popup activity justify a source pause?
A source pause needs several signals pointing in the same direction. Concentrated timing, repeated devices, implausible geography, and backend rejection can supply that evidence. Tracking and route integrity should be verified first.
Why should popup network reports separate devices?
Device groups can differ in both mechanics and customer value. Window behavior, page usability, and form completion help explain the difference. Keeping device results separate stops a strong desktop result from hiding a broken mobile path, or the reverse.
What supports expanding a popup network beyond its first sources?
Expansion needs stable accepted economics, reliable behavior, and evidence that the initial result was not concentrated in one unusual placement. Each added source group should enter with its own reversible limit.
